The purpose of a motorcycle battery is primarily to provide power for starting the engine and to supply electricity to various electrical components of the motorcycle. When the ignition key is turned, the battery sends a burst of electrical energy to the starter motor, which cranks the engine and initiates the combustion process. Additionally, once the engine is running, the battery helps to stabilize the electrical system by supplying voltage to lights, signaling devices, and other electrical accessories, ensuring that they function properly.

This function is critical because without a fully charged and operational battery, starting the engine would be nearly impossible, and electrical systems would fail to operate effectively. The battery also plays a key role in absorbing voltage spikes, which protects sensitive electronic components from damage caused by sudden changes in electrical load.
